Sélection d'un répertoire...

Description

C'est une boîte de dialogue qui permet d'obtenir un répertoire que l'utilisateur à sélectionné. Ce n'est pas un programme mais c'est surtout pour ceux qui possède le Framework1.0 parce que je sais qu'il n'y pas le composnt permettant de sélectionneur un répertoire comme avec le framework1.1. J'ai aussi créer cette form pour mieux comprendre le fonctionnement des Treeview et pouvoir visualiser les dossier du system pas celui-ci.
Donc voilà, pour ceux qui on framework 1.0, vous avez juste a insérer cette form et mettre ces quelque ligne:

Dim selectrépertoire as New FrmSelectDir
If selectrépertoire.Showdialg = dialogresult.ok Then
path = selectrépertoire.SelectedPath
End if

Il affiche la form, ce qui va permttre à l'utilisateur de sélectionner un répertoire et donner cette URL à la variable path (selectrépertoire.SelectedPath)

J'ai commenté cette form pour comprendre le fonctoinnement des branche d'arbre dans un treeview qui représentera un arbre bien fleurit... (avec les dossier de votre system...). Je m'excuse pour les fautes d'orthographe...

Il y a aussi les propriétés suivante que j'ai ajouté:

selectrépertoire.ShowNewFolderButton as boolean
Ce qui détermine si le bouton pour créer un nouveau répertoire est utilisable par l'utilisateur ou pas...

selectrépertoire.Description as String
Qui détermine le texte pour décrire à l'utilisateur ce qu'il doit faire... (il y a déjà un texte par défaut).

Conclusion :


Ce n'est pas une source parfaite, mais j'espère qu'elle pourra aider plusieur personnes. J'ai moi-même mis deux après-midi pour comprendre le fonctionnement (l'ajout des répertoire dans un treeview).

Il est peut-être un peu lent parce qu'il cherche tout les répertoire de l'ordinateur...

J'aurais bien voulu créer un composant, mais je ne sait pas dutout comment en faire un alors c'est déjà un premier pas...

Blanc

Codes Sources

A voir également

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.